Mediatized worlds of communitization

young people as localists, centrists, multi-localists and pluralists

Andreas Hepp , Matthias Berg, Cindy Roitsch

pp. 174-203

The role of the media in "communities' and "community-building" has been a fundamental question since the beginning of media and communication research. However, the focus of this research had mainly been the single community as such. To take some examples, one line of investigation has been the role of the media in building up the imagined community of the nation; another, the media as a reference point of fan cultures or certain scenes. More recently there has been increasing research on new forms of community-building in the internet and social web.
